Two familiar figures emerge from a fractured scene.
Goofy and Donald Duck, their forms surfacing as if from the earth itself, caught mid-brawl against a pale blue backdrop. The moment feels playful yet unsettling, cartoon nostalgia warped into something layered and strange.
In The Brawl, Alejandro Meza works in oil on canvas with a double-painting technique, constructing the illusion of collage. Striped and spotted abstractions run horizontally across the surface, partially obscuring the underpainting and heightening the sense of disruption. The result is both humorous and charged, a dialogue between popular culture and painterly experimentation.

Alejandro Meza is a contemporary painter based in New York City, originally trained at the Mexico City National School of Fine Art. His work layers references that span from the grandeur of the Baroque to the kitsch of popular icons and cartoons, weaving them into richly anachronistic compositions.
In his ongoing series Baroque Hubbub, Meza explores the tension between color, composition, and gesture—balancing playfulness with precision. His paintings obscure as much as they reveal, creating juxtapositions that open into fragmented narratives. Sensual yet enigmatic, his work reflects the complexity of contemporary global culture, where histories, images, and symbols continually collide.
